Subject: ReportForge 4.2 — sort stability fix

Team,

ReportForge 4.2 replaces the quicksort in the column sorter with a stable merge sort. Previously, rows with equal keys could reorder between runs, which caused diff noise in scheduled exports and confused downstream reconciliation at Vantry Logistics. Equal-key rows now preserve input order. Memory use rises slightly (one auxiliary buffer per sort pass); we measured no meaningful latency change. Maintainers comparing old and new exports should reference the build below.

trace token, fafog-kageg: htk4_98e6

## Ticket: Autocomplete Index Drift — Searchlet

The staging autocomplete index rebuilds in ~4 minutes; production takes over 40. Root cause: production's shard count and refresh interval were hand-edited during an incident last quarter and never synced back to the repo. The drift also disabled prefix caching, which explains the slow typeahead reports. Future maintainers should treat the repo as the source of truth and reconcile on deploy. The intended production configuration is recorded below.

deployment values, yadup-kadug:
[sorys]
port = 5672
team = noveth
host = sorys.orvexcorp.example
region = south-4
access_code = ac_deddc1
timeout_ms = 1500

HANDOVER NOTE — For the Incoming Director

The revised sales-commission scheme takes effect next quarter. Key changes: tiered rates replace flat 6%, accelerators kick in above target, and the Hallowell accounts are excluded pending review. Payroll has the new tables; regional leads were briefed last month. Expect pushback from the Greystone team on clawback terms. Full modelling sits with Finance. The confidential note appended below summarises our direction:

board note of bawep-tajef: Queniusek Systems plans to raise the Quenvan list price by 53.1 percent in March. The pricing group signed off on a budget of $176.4 million for Project Drueth. The renewal with Casionix Partners closes at $142.5 million a year, 8.3 percent below the last contract. Project Fraax slips by six weeks because of the tooling delay.